In recent years, there has been a growing recognition of the importance of mental health in discussions surrounding the legacy of slavery. Therapists and mental health professionals are increasingly focusing on culturally sensitive approaches that honor the unique experiences of those affected by historical oppression. This shift acknowledges that healing cannot occur in isolation; it must involve a collective effort to confront the past and foster resilience within communities. Initiatives that promote storytelling, cultural expression, and community support are vital in helping individuals process their trauma and reclaim their narratives. By prioritizing mental health, society can begin to dismantle the barriers that have long hindered healing and empowerment.
